El Achiote in world map

El Achiote in world map. The following map shows the location of El Achiote in the world. Latitude and longitude of El Achiote: 10°44'18.4"N, 84°57'31.3"W

Please select map: El Achiote in world mapMap of El Achiote
El Achiote in world map
El Achiote, Costa Rica in world map